Our region’s Project Homeless Connect is coming up soon: Tuesday, September 29 at the Mass Mutual Center, 8 am to 2 pm.  This is a great event for people who are homeless or at-risk of homelessness to access multiple services in one place on one day. 

This year’s event will have a strong focus on homeless families, and event organizers are arranging transportation for homeless families staying in two area motels: the Quality Inn in West Springfield and the Howard Johnsons on Boston Road in Springfield.  These two motels alone are housing over 100 homeless families.  Other homeless families are also welcome, but we are unable to provide transporation for all motels. 

Over 80 vendors will be at the event offering housing search assistance (including the on-site presence of housing authorities and landlords); access to public benefits; health and dental care; behavioral health services; access to IDs and birth certificates; legal and advocacy assistance; employment services; and veterans’ services.  Also available: haircuts, chair massage, hot breakfast and lunch, music and children’s activities.

This year’s event will have an associated court session in District Court, which is for the purpose of clearing warrants associated with non-violent misdemeanor crimes.  Last year, in this special session, 6 people got warrants cleared and the underlying offense dealt with–clearing the warrant and ending the court case.  Pre-screening is required for the warrant program, in order to ensure up-front that a person is appropriate for the program.  For prescreening, contact Lizzy Malave, 413-886-5019 or [email protected], and be prepared to provide full name, date of birth, and social security number.
